LINGO1 antisense RNA 2 (LINGO1-AS2) is a long non-coding RNA transcribed from the LINGO1 locus in the antisense direction relative to the LINGO1 protein-coding gene. Like other antisense lncRNAs, LINGO1-AS2 does not code for a protein but is thought to play a regulatory role over LINGO1 gene expression, primarily through mechanisms possible in cis (acting near its own locus). Antisense lncRNAs can regulate their sense gene partners by affecting transcription, promoter/enhancer activity, chromatin structure, or by direct RNA-mediated action. In general, antisense RNAs may serve either oncogenic or tumor-suppressive functions and are increasingly being viewed as therapeutic targets or agents, although there is currently no direct evidence or clinical application for LINGO1-AS2 itself. More broadly, LINGO1 protein itself is implicated as a central regulator of neuronal survival, myelination, and axonal regeneration in the central nervous system, but LINGO1-AS2's exact biological and pathological roles remain to be clarified.
Antisense lncRNAs in general may regulate neighboring gene expression, sometimes by modulating chromatin state, interfering with transcription, or RNA-RNA interactions, but no specific mechanism of action for drugs targeting LINGO1-AS2 is known.
